Stellenbosch
Stellenbosch, with its charming Cape Dutch and Victorian architecture, is a picturesque town in the Cape Winelands region that offers visitors a delightful mix of history, culture, and of course, world-class wines.
It’s part of the renowned Stellenbosch wine route, which is home to some of the most prestigious wineries in South Africa. With over 150 wine estates to choose from, wine enthusiasts will be spoiled for choice. Each estate has its own unique charm and offers a variety of wine tasting experiences, from cellar tours to guided tastings. Visitors can explore the beautiful vineyards, indulge in wine pairings, and learn about the winemaking process.
Along With the wine, Stellenbosch also boasts a vibrant arts and culture scene, with galleries, museums, and street art to admire. It truly is a destination that caters to all interests.
Franschhoek
Nestled in the heart of the Cape Winelands, Franschhoek beckons with its charming streets, award-winning vineyards, and a rich history that dates back to the 17th century. This picturesque town is renowned for its wine tasting experiences and Cape Dutch architecture, making it a must-visit destination for wine enthusiasts and history buffs alike.
Here are four reasons why Franschhoek should be on your wine tour itinerary:
Wine Tasting: Franschhoek boasts a stack of world-class vineyards, offering visitors the chance to indulge in wine tastings of exquisite varietals. From bold reds to crisp whites, there’s something to please every palate.
Cape Dutch Architecture: Franschhoek is home to a number of well-preserved Cape Dutch buildings, showcasing the unique architectural style that blends European and African influences. Take a leisurely stroll through the town and admire the beautiful gabled facades and thatched roofs.
Scenic Beauty: Surrounded by majestic mountains and lush vineyards, Franschhoek offers breathtaking views at every turn. The picturesque landscapes provide the perfect backdrop for a day of wine tasting and exploration.
Rich History: Franschhoek has a fascinating history dating back to its hotel by French Huguenot settlers in the 17th century. Learn about the town’s heritage through visits to museums and historical sites, and gain insight into the cultural influences that have shaped Franschhoek into the vibrant destination it’s today.
Franschhoek truly offers a delightful blend of wine, architecture, natural beauty, and history, making it an essential stop on any wine tour in the Cape Winelands.
Paarl
Paarl, a charming town in the Cape Winelands, offers visitors a delightful mix of historical landmarks, breathtaking landscapes, and exceptional wine tasting experiences.
Known for its prestigious wine estates, Paarl is a must-visit destination for wine enthusiasts. The town is home to some of the oldest and most renowned vineyards in the region, offering a wide variety of wine tasting experiences. Visitors can explore the beautiful vineyards, learn about the winemaking process, and indulge in tastings of award-winning wines.
Some of the popular wine estates in Paarl include Fairview, Nederburg, and Spice Route. With its picturesque surroundings and rich wine heritage, Paarl promises a memorable and enjoyable wine tour experience for all.
